The start of 2022 has been an improvement on the start of 2021 - if nothing else because we can leave our homes.

But last year was eventful despite the ongoing fallout of the Covid-19 pandemic. Consolidation activity continued at pace, with private equity continuing to play a major role, and last year's tax reforms will give advisers plenty to think about.

So what does 2022 have in store for advisers this year? FTAdviser's digital editor Damian Fantato is joined by reporters Amy Austin, Ruby Hinchliffe, Sonia Rach and Sally Hickey to find out.

They discuss the FCA's continued crackdown on defined benefit transfers, the growth of cryptocurrencies, how ESG regulation could affect advisers over the next year, and what other areas the FCA can be expected to focus on.
